Abstinence and Health
The minds of the suffering ones must be led to grasp the hope of
deliverance from special peril. Speak to them hopeful words, words
of courage. There are those patronizing our sanitariums whom the
[264]
Lord will heal if they will abstain from the use of liquor and drugs
and will use simple and safe remedies to counteract disease brought
on through perverted appetite. If they will act their part to break the
spell of the enemy by firmly resisting temptation, and will surrender
themselves to the One who gave His life for sinful souls, they will
become sons and daughters of God.
All who indulge the appetite, waste the physical energies, and
weaken the moral power, will sooner or later feel the retribution that
follows the transgression of physical law.
Christ gave His life to purchase redemption for the sinner. The
world’s Redeemer knew that indulgence of appetite was bringing
physical debility and deadening the perceptive faculties so that sa-
cred and eternal things could not be discerned. He knew that self-
indulgence was perverting the moral powers, and that man’s great
need was conversion—in heart and mind and soul, from the life of
self-indulgence to one of the self-denial and self-sacrifice....
